Bulldog way right here! Selflessness right here! In PE, we change squad lines about every six weeks so that we can have new leaders and new teams. I assign points to a particular squad if they are doing the right thing or if they win a competition. The students in the winning squad receive a small prize. We have done this every day this week. I overheard these four selfless students in different classes tell their teammates, "You go first," when choosing a prize! I never told them to say this. I was just listening. Congratulations to the four of you for setting a beautiful example for your classmates!

🧩💛 **Our 1st Graders Took on a Shape Escape Room!** 💛🧩 Today our classrooms were filled with excitement, teamwork, and LOTS of shape talk! Our 1st graders worked together to solve a Shape Escape Room challenge! Each team was given 4 mystery envelopes and inside each one was a different 2D shape challenge. In order to unlock each envelope, students had to collaborate, listen to one another, and use what they’ve been learning about 2D Shapes.
The envelopes consisted of:
đź”· Composed new shapes using smaller ones
🔺 Identified and named 2D shapes
đźź© Sorted shapes by their attributes
🔵 Distinguished between similar shapes
The best part? Watching them encourage each other. 💛 “I think it’s a rectangle because…” “Let’s try this one!” “We can do it together!” When that final lock opened, the cheers were priceless! 🎉 They were so proud and they definitely earned their special prize after unlocking all four envelopes. More than just a fun game, this activity gave students the chance to show what they know, practice teamwork, and build confidence in such a meaningful way. What a fun way to learn! ✨
